Marvel Removes INHUMANS From Its Movie Release Schedule

Movie InhumansMarvel by Joey Paur

It doesn’t look like we’ll be seeing that Inhuman’s movie anytime soon. Disney and Marvel had previously scheduled it for release on July 12th, 2019. Now in an updated release schedule, the movie has been removed, and it currently has no release date.

The news comes from Wall Street Journal's Ben Fritz. This isn’t the first time the film’s release date has had issues. It was originally slated for release on November 2nd, 2018 before it was moved to the July date. One of the reasons why Inhumans was removed could be because Indiana Jones 5 is scheduled to hit theaters on July 19th, 2019, which is a week after Inhumans. I imagine they didn’t want to go up against that. 

Then Spider-Man was recently thrown into the mix, which Marvel Studios President Kevin Feige also said plays a factor in the shuffle. When previously asked about the Inhumans movie at the Captain America: Civil War press junket, he said:

"Since we made our initial phase three announcement, we added Spider-Man, which was a big, joyous coup for us. We added Ant-Man and the Wasp, which was a big, fun continuation of that story for us. Walt Disney Company has announced an Indiana Jones film for right around that same time. So I think it will shuffle off the current date that it's on right now. How far down it shuffles, I'm not sure yet."

I'm sure Marvel is still planning on an Inhumans movie, and Vin Diesel is expected to star in the film. There’s just a little restructuring going on at the moment, and we’ll keep you updated on what happens.
